B
In her tiny Athens apartment, 93-year-ld Ianna Matsuka has knitted thusands f brightly clred scarves fr children in need frm Greece t Ukraine, and she has n plans t quit just yet. “Until I die, I will be knitting,” Matsuka says. Since she tk up knitting in the 1990s, Matsuka has easily made ver 3,000 scarves, her daughter estimates.
In the hallway by the dr, shpping bags filled with her latest creatins await their new hme. A knitted blanket is thrwn ver the sfa where she spends her days.
Initially distributed t friends, the scarves were later cntributed t children’s shelters acrss Greece as the stck expanded. Then, thrugh acquaintances, they reached children in Bsnia and Ukraine. The latest batch f 70 went t a refugee camp near Athens this winter via the UN refugee agency.
Her daughter, Angeliki, narrates drawings and mails her mther has received ver the years: “Thank yu, be well, keep ging. Yu gave jy t children, yu gave jy t peple.” That’s her nly reward: a letter, a few wrds. Matsuka knits ne scarf a day, nw with small imperfectins. Her visin is impaired and she suffers frm severe facial pain, a cnditin knwn as trigeminal neuralgia (三叉神經(jīng)痛). Angeliki says her mther is an example f resilience and ptimism. Matsuka wakes up every mrning, drinks a glass f milk, puts n her pearl earrings and gets t wrk. She takes a break fr lunch and a nap, and then painstakingly knits int the night.
She may have even fund the secret t a lng life in it, she says. “It’s the happiness I get frm giving.” she says, sitting beside a big blue bag brimming with yarn (紗線). “Until I die, I will be knitting,” Matsuka says. Her knitting needles click thrugh her expert fingers, her nails painted red. “It brings me jy t share them.”

C
Have yu ever jyusly stepped ut t yur backyard garden, freshly made cffee in hand, nly t find yur attentively cared-fr plants and herbs dying? Was the sil t dry? Did pests find their way in? During times like these, sme frustrated gardeners may wish their rses wuld just tell them what they need. A new prject in the UK is trying t see if that cncept can be demnstrated in the real wrld.
Next year, the Ryal Hrticultural Sciety in England will shw an “intelligent garden” that uses an AI mdel t mnitr the garden’s envirnment and infrm gardeners when it needs care. Visitrs can ask the AI-pwered garden questins. The mdel culd then respnd with phrases like “I need a bit mre water,” r “I culd use a haircut” depending n data captured in the sil. Aside frm the pleasant nvelty f chatting with plants, the garden will prvide visitrs with a physical representatin f the many ways Al and Internet f Things technlgies culd be used t enhance sustainability and cnservatin effrts.
When the garden is uncvered, it will rely n a netwrk f sensrs nestled thrughut the garden measuring envirnmental factrs like sil misture, and nutrient levels as well as wind and prjected rainfall. All f that data is then sent t a specially designed AI mdel hused in a pavilin (亭子) at the back f the garden. The mdel can then analyze thse factrs and infrm gardener f timely feeding, r watering.
Several currently available apps als use AI t help gardeners identify unknwn plants by cmparing a pht f them against a large nline database. But as past reprting has shwn, simply trusting an Al t tell yu whether a plant f unknwn rigin is safe t eat isn’t wise,and culd have dangerus results.

D
“Have yu eaten yet?”, a familiar Chinese greeting, might be the title f this bk, but fr the authr Cheuk Kwan-and fr almst every restaurateur he interviews-fd is nly the entry pint. Because “running a Chinese
restaurant is the easiest path fr new Chinese immigrants t integrate int the hst sciety,” Kwan writes in his memir.
We first met Nisy Jim wh arrived in Vancuver at the age f 12. T gain Jim’s entry, his father btained the identity papers f a dead Canadian resident named Chw Jim Kk, whse name Jim wuld keep fr the rest f his life. Fr years, he labured in the kitchen f a Chinese restaurant until he was called back t China t marry a wman. The cuple returned t Canada t pen their wn Chinese cafe in a remte twn, raised seven children and served egg rlls and chp suey (雜碎): fd that was neither Canadian nr accrding t Jim, “what Chinese peple eat.”
The trace f Jim’s life bears a striking resemblance t that f Maurice Sng, wh helped at his father’s general stre in San Fernand, befre running a Chinese restaurant there with his new wife, wh was married t him frm his hme village.
Frm the Arctic t Africa t the Amazn, perseverance, ecnmic pragmatism (經(jīng)濟務(wù)實) and resurcefulness bind the lives f Chinese immigrant restaurateurs all ver the wrld and inspire their diverse menus.
At its best, Kwan’s bk reveals the ways in which diaspric (大移居的) Chinese restaurants are like test kitchens experimenting in pprtunities fr a better life, hwever cludy that pursuit might be. As in the case f Jim and Maurice, many wh venture n the immigratin jurney are children with little say in the matter.
Kwan’s bk is a kind f lve letter t his varied hmes and a memrial t his jurney thrugh them, as reflected thrugh the lives f faraway strangers. “T me, a hme is abut finding a cmmunity where yu feel yu belng,” Kwan writes tward the end.
